The surgeries are divided as follows..<\/span>\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\"><a href=\"http:\/\/www.beliteweight.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/Screenshot-2.jpg\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" alt=\"vsg weight loss surgery gastric sleeve \" class=\"aligncenter size-full wp-image-5805\" height=\"457\" src=\"http:\/\/www.beliteweight.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/Screenshot-2.jpg\" width=\"516\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.beliteweight.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/Screenshot-2.jpg 516w, https:\/\/www.beliteweight.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/Screenshot-2-300x265.jpg 300w, https:\/\/www.beliteweight.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/Screenshot-2-338x300.jpg 338w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 516px) 100vw, 516px\" \/><\/a><\/span>\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Wiih Core Restrictive procedures the intake of food is reduced drastically placing the body at <strong>a greater risk of developing a vitamin deficiency <\/strong>through a lack of food. Furthermore, with Core Malabsorptive proceures there is <strong>intentional reduction of nutrient absorption<\/strong> by the body.<\/span>\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Studies show that patients who have developed metabolic deficiencies after Roux-en-Y gastric bypass responded well to <strong>postoperative supplements<\/strong> and the risk of developing micronutrient deficiencies decreased over time. Studies further show <strong>that adherence to a strict vitamin <\/strong><strong>and dietary regime<\/strong> as suggested by most surgeons, protects patients from <strong>developing severe metabolic deficiencies after RYGB and BP.<\/strong><\/span>\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">It is always wise to prevent a nutritional deficiency through proper supplementation than to treat it afterwards.<\/span>\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\"><span style=\"font-size:16px;\"><strong>What Can I Do After Weight Loss Surgery?<\/strong><\/span><\/span>\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Lifelong vitamins and minerals are <strong>VITAL <\/strong>to prevent deficiencies since your food consumption and\/pr absoption is dramatically reduced. Certain vitamins are more important for those adjusting to life after weight loss surgery.&nbsp; <\/span>\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">While patients should also seek out specific vitamin supplements specifically for patients, such as <strong>Bariatric Advantage,<\/strong> below are some general guidelines and information. *There are general guidelines &#8211; <u><strong>Please check with your Primary Care Physician to see if your particular situation requires different or extra vitamins and supplements. <\/strong><\/u><\/span>\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t<strong><span style=\"font-size:16px;\">Vital Vitamins<\/span><\/strong>\n<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\"><strong>Adult Strength Multi-Vitamin<\/strong><\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\"><strong>Calcium Citrate w\/ Vitamin D or Bone Health Blend <\/strong>(1500-1800 mg a day)<\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\"><strong>B-12 <\/strong>(1000 mcg a day. Look for Methylcobalamin first, a better active version of B-12)<\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\"><strong>Iron <\/strong>(males up 18mg a day, demales 29mg)<\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"font-size:16px;\"><strong>Supplement Guidelines<\/strong><\/span>\n<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:16px;\"><span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Do not take Calcium\/Magnesium and Iron at the same time<\/span><\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:16px;\"><span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Do not take fiber products with your vitamins<\/span><\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:16px;\"><span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Do not take vitamins\/supplements on an empy stomache<\/span><\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:16px;\"><span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Use chewable, liquid, gummies or powders,<\/span><\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"font-size:16px;\"><strong>Probiotics<\/strong><\/span>\n<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Start right after surgery.<\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Balances trillions of bacteria in our gut.<\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Promotes healthy immune system.<\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Helps with digestion and nutrient absoption<\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Promotes bowel functionality<\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"font-size:16px;\"><strong>Omega 3 Fatty Acids<\/strong><\/span>\n<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:16px;\"><span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Fish Oils, Flaxseeds, Hemp Hearts, &amp; Chia Seeds<\/span><\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:16px;\"><span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Balances hormones, Protects Brain, Enhances Skin and Eyes<\/span><\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:16px;\"><span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Promotes bowel functionality<\/span><\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"font-size:16px;\"><strong>Additional Supplements<\/strong><\/span>\n<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Vitamin D3<\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Vitamin B1 (Thiamin)<\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<li>\n\t\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Magnesium (Healthy bones, teeth, &amp; skin. Promotes sleep. Take in evening with Calcium)<\/span>\n\t<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"font-size:16px;\"><strong>Conclusion<\/strong><\/span>\n<\/p>\n<p>\n\t<span style=\"font-size:14px;\">Although vitamins are important for everyone, they are especially Vitamins are critical for patients undergoing or undergone a bariatric procedure.
